2010 Why Is Cotton Crazy?

Theoretically, the market price of commodities will be determined by its supply-demand relationship. From this point of view, in the year 2009-2010, cotton consumption in the world exceeded the output by 15 percentage points, which led to a sharp decline in international cotton stocks, resulting in a surge in cotton prices.
